ENDING THE INTELLIGENCE WINTER
You have two twentysomethings in the 2000s Li & Hassabis who revived the importance of 3 neuroscience elders valuation of Neural Networks. These teachers are now in their 60s Lecun & Bengio and 70s Hinton
Li (Fei-Fei) is at the roots of the the thaw in the ai winter because she unselfishly invested 10 years in building imagenet- 2000 identities humans grow up and develop with - be these animals , parts of the human body, plants, engineering tools , or more intangible ids like how facial expressions or body language may help youth decode what emotional outburst a group of humans is about to unleash. If you read Li's "worlds I see" nov 2023 (probably the most vital intelligence book yet publlshed thanks to Melinda Gates extraordinary new women empowering library moments of... you will find almost every western academic trap blocked her until she was welcomed in stanford from 2009. Although the science of 200 million proteiins identities revealed by Hassabis Deep Mind training of computers to play logic games may be today's biggest ai platform leap, its unlikely he would have got silicon valley funding if Li's computer vision work had not woken up the valley. In turn her work only woke up the valley when a NN algorithm won 2012's imagenet- without the teachings of Hinton, Lecun & Bengio - graduate students wouldnt have made this leap. 2012's good news also woke up chip manufacturing see Taiwanese American Jensen Huang's Nvidia testimony; 5 years of R&D stimulated by Imagenet's leap was needed to design a chip with 80 billion tranaistors; and another few years to scale manufacturing these super GPUs of AI.
